Copper Alloy, UNS C16500, H04 Temper, Bar
Categories: Metal; Nonferrous Metal; Copper Alloy

Material Notes: Temper: Hard

Fabrication Properties: Excellent Suitability – Soldering, Brazing, Butt Weld, Capacity for Being Cold Worked; Good Suitability – Capacity for Being Hot Formed; Fair Suitability – Gas Shielded Arc Welding

Common Fabrication Processes: Drawing; Etching; Forming and Bending; Heading and Upsetting; Hot forging; Piercing and Punching

Typical uses: Clips; Contacts; Flat Cable; Springs; Trolley Wire; Resistance Welding Electrodes

Applicable Specifications: Wire – Trolly ASTM B9, ASTM B105

Physical PropertiesOriginal ValueComments
Density 0.321 lb/in³
 
Mechanical PropertiesOriginal ValueComments
Hardness, Rockwell B 60
@Thickness 9.52 mm
Tensile Strength 56.0 ksi
@Thickness 9.52 mm
Tensile Strength, Yield 52.0 ksi
@Thickness 9.52 mm
0.5% Ext
Elongation at Break 23 %
@Thickness 9.52 mm
Tensile Modulus 17000 ksi
Machinability 20 %
 
Electrical PropertiesOriginal ValueComments
Electrical Resistivity 0.00000290 ohm-cm60% IACS
 
Thermal PropertiesOriginal ValueComments
CTE, linear 9.80 µin/in-°F
@Temperature 20.0 - 300 °C
Specific Heat Capacity 0.0900 BTU/lb-°F
Thermal Conductivity 146 BTU-in/hr-ft²-°F
Melting Point <= 1958 °F
Liquidus 1958 °F
Annealing Point 800 - 1450 °F
 
Processing PropertiesOriginal ValueComments
Hot-Working Temperature 1425 - 1600 °F
 
Component Elements PropertiesOriginal ValueComments
Cadmium, Cd 0.60 - 1.0 %
Copper, Cu 98.3 - 98.9 %As Balance
Iron, Fe <= 0.020 %
Tin, Sn 0.50 - 0.70 %
 
Descriptive Properties
US EPA Registered AntimicrobialYes
